Hi.  My name is Mark.  I’m a Scorpio and I dig long walks on the beach….no wait, wrong bio.  My fascination with pinball started in the mid-1970’s at a local arcade called, appropriately enough “The Escape Hatch”.  As a pre-teen, I’d go there every chance I could to take on “Gangbusters” – a shooting game of the late 60’s-early ‘70’s era,  Whirly Bird- a helicopter game, Space Race- an incredibly simplistic video game, and pin games like Bally Wizard, Bally Hi-Deal, and Old Chicago.  As the years went on, the solid state games appeared like Bobby Orr Power Play, Evil Knievel, Harlem Globetrotters, and Paragon.  After a brief flirtation with videos such as Galaga, PacMan and Crazy Climber, I eventually would return to the pins.

With the advent of another arcade in town (The Corner Pocket), I had many exciting pinball options to take on.  CP had Globetrotters, Flight 2000 (my favorite game at the time), a Rolling Stones (with that back glass which would make any Teen-ager feel a little odd), Nine Ball, Eight Ball Deluxe LE, and the list goes on.  Jump forward to 1999 when my industrious little brother (also a WVPPC Member) Steve checked into getting a pinball machine on this new “Ebay” online place.  Thanks to his initiative, I have been able to re-live my childhood/teen-age years and pass along my love of all things pinball to my children.  As my fortieth birthday rapidly approaches, I fondly remember the fleeting days of youth and will “hold onto sixteen as long as I can”
